If you’re a consultant, coach, or small business owner, getting new clients or customers in the door is as important as keeping the ones you already have. Existing ones provide ongoing revenue, while getting new ones is vital for growth.
New customer acquisition ideas run the gamut from email marketing, social media advertising, and influencer partnerships, to collaborations and more. One of the best ways is through referrals from happy clients, partners, or fellow professionals.

Customers in general don’t like hard sales tactics. In fact, most of them loath such an approach. Even the success you may have in a few rare cases doesn’t outweigh alienating the majority of your prospects.
A better approach is to focus on building trust and rapport so your prospects feel they’re making their own buying decisions, not being forced. You want to persuade them, not make them feel they’re being pressured.

We put in hour after hour to ensure our business provides top-level service for our clients. But when it comes to promoting ourselves and our work, some of us have a mental block. We come up with all sorts of creative reasons for why promotion simply isn’t right for us. The fact is, though, that we can build influence by self promotion – and are thus able to better achieve our goal of growing our business and helping even more people. So what’s behind the “promotion shy” stance so many take? Often it’s discomfort and fear.
